Subject: [for-next][PATCH 04/17] tracing: Clear all trace buffers when unloaded module event was used

From: "Steven Rostedt (Red Hat)" <srostedt@redhat.com>

Currently we do not know what buffer a module event was enabled in.
On unload, it is safest to clear all buffer instances, not just the
top level buffer.

Todo: Clear only the buffer that the event was used in. The
infrastructure is there to do this, but it makes the code a bit
more complex. Lets get the current code vetted before we add that.

 kernel/trace/trace.c        |   10 ++++++++--
 kernel/trace/trace.h        |    2 +-
 kernel/trace/trace_events.c |   10 +++++++---
 3 files changed, 16 insertions(+), 6 deletions(-)

diff --git a/kernel/trace/trace.c b/kernel/trace/trace.c
index f743121..d852165 100644
--- a/kernel/trace/trace.c
+++ b/kernel/trace/trace.c
@@ -911,9 +911,15 @@ void tracing_reset_current(int cpu)
 	tracing_reset(&global_trace, cpu);
 }
 
-void tracing_reset_current_online_cpus(void)
+void tracing_reset_all_online_cpus(void)
 {
-	tracing_reset_online_cpus(&global_trace);
+	struct trace_array *tr;
+
+	mutex_lock(&trace_types_lock);
+	list_for_each_entry(tr, &ftrace_trace_arrays, list) {
+		tracing_reset_online_cpus(tr);
+	}
+	mutex_unlock(&trace_types_lock);
 }
 
 #define SAVED_CMDLINES 128
diff --git a/kernel/trace/trace.h b/kernel/trace/trace.h
index 50a9c81..e9486c74d 100644
--- a/kernel/trace/trace.h
+++ b/kernel/trace/trace.h
@@ -492,7 +492,7 @@ int tracing_is_enabled(void);
 void tracing_reset(struct trace_array *tr, int cpu);
 void tracing_reset_online_cpus(struct trace_array *tr);
 void tracing_reset_current(int cpu);
-void tracing_reset_current_online_cpus(void);
+void tracing_reset_all_online_cpus(void);
 int tracing_open_generic(struct inode *inode, struct file *filp);
 struct dentry *trace_create_file(const char *name,
 				 umode_t mode,
diff --git a/kernel/trace/trace_events.c b/kernel/trace/trace_events.c
index 9a7dc4b..a376ab5 100644
--- a/kernel/trace/trace_events.c
+++ b/kernel/trace/trace_events.c
@@ -1649,14 +1649,18 @@ static void trace_module_remove_events(struct module *mod)
 		list_del(&file_ops->list);
 		kfree(file_ops);
 	}
+	up_write(&trace_event_mutex);
 
 	/*
 	 * It is safest to reset the ring buffer if the module being unloaded
-	 * registered any events that were used.
+	 * registered any events that were used. The only worry is if
+	 * a new module gets loaded, and takes on the same id as the events
+	 * of this module. When printing out the buffer, traced events left
+	 * over from this module may be passed to the new module events and
+	 * unexpected results may occur.
 	 */
 	if (clear_trace)
-		tracing_reset_current_online_cpus();
-	up_write(&trace_event_mutex);
+		tracing_reset_all_online_cpus();
 }
 
 static int trace_module_notify(struct notifier_block *self,
-- 
1.7.10.4
